BTS, the global music sensation from South Korea, continued to dominate the United States music market in 2021 with an unprecedented presence on the best-selling digital songs chart. On January sixth, Billboard announced data compiled by MRC Data, formerly known as Nielsen Music, revealing that BTS had achieved something extraordinary. The group owned four of the top ten best-selling digital songs in the United States for the year. This accomplishment not only reinforced their commercial success but also underscored their growing influence and staying power in the highly competitive American music industry.

Topping the list at number one was BTS’s massive summer anthem “Butter,” which sold a staggering one point eight nine million digital copies. This track became a cultural phenomenon upon its release, praised for its catchy melody, smooth choreography, and upbeat energy. It maintained a long-standing presence at the top of the Billboard Hot 100 chart and quickly became one of the most recognizable songs of the year.

“Butter” was not just a song; it was a statement a demonstration of BTS’s command over the global music scene and their ability to deliver hits that resonate with a diverse audience. Following closely behind was “Permission to Dance,” which secured the third spot with four hundred four thousand digital copies sold. The track, infused with messages of hope and unity, was released as a follow-up to “Butter” and served as a reminder of BTS’s commitment to uplifting fans during uncertain times.

Their earlier all-English track, “Dynamite,” continued to show strong sales in 2021, coming in at number six with three hundred eight thousand copies. Despite being released in 2020, its enduring popularity proved the group’s songs have a lasting impact. Lastly, their powerful collaboration with Coldplay, “My Universe,” ranked at number seven with two hundred eighty-seven thousand copies sold. This song symbolized not only a merging of two massive musical acts but also a message of love transcending language, genre, and distance. Together, these achievements exemplify BTS’s unparalleled reach and artistic versatility.
